Question

a shooter was asked how many birds he had in his bag. he answered that these were all sparrows but six. pigeons but six and all duck but six, How many birds he had in the bag in all?

options-

[a] 9

[b] 18

[c] 36

[d] 72

Solution

Answer :

We know from the statement given in question

There are all sparrows but six " means " that six birds are not sparrows but only pigeons and ducks .

So,

Total number of pigeons + Total number of ducks = 6 ------------- ( 1 )

And

There are all pigeons but six " means " that six birds are not pigeons but only sparrows and ducks .

So,

Total number of sparrows + Total number of ducks = 6 ------------- ( 2 )

And

There are all ducks but six " means " that six birds are not ducks but only sparrows and pigeons .

So,

Total number of sparrows + Total number of pigeons = 6 ------------- ( 3 )

Now we add equation 1 , 2 and 3 , and get

2 ( Total number of sparrows + Total number of pigeons + Total number of ducks ) = 18

So,

Total number of sparrows + Total number of pigeons + Total number of ducks = 9 ,

So there 9 birds in his bag .
